Purple Style Labs share price makes a weak debut, stock opens with a 7% discount at ₹535 apiece on NSE

Purple Style Labs shares had a lackluster market debut, opening at ₹535 on the National Stock Exchange. This opening price was approximately 7% lower than the IPO price, indicating a muted reception from investors on the first trading day.
For investors, a weak debut suggests that the company's valuation may have been viewed as expensive relative to its current market position. It also highlights that the IPO, which was subscribed 1.29 times, did not generate the high demand typically seen in the retail segment.

Purple Style Labs shares debuted poorly on September 7, opening at ₹ 535, 6.96% lower than the IPO price. The IPO was subscribed 1.29 times with notable celebrity investors, aiming to raise ₹ 680 crore for various investments.
